Vulnerability Description
Unspecified vulnerability in Oracle MySQL 5.6.28 and earlier and 5.7.10 and earlier allows local users to affect availability via vectors related to Options.

Affected Products
| Vendor | Product | Versions |
|---|---|---|
| Oracle | Mysql | >= 5.6.0, <= 5.6.28 |
| Redhat | Enterprise Linux | 6.0 |
| Canonical | Ubuntu Linux | 12.04 |
